Effectively collaborating with clients and understanding their video editing requirements is crucial for delivering a successful and satisfying end product. Here are some key steps and strategies to achieve this:
1. Active Listening: When engaging with clients, it's essential to actively listen to their ideas, objectives, and vision for the project. Take the time to understand their specific needs, preferences, and desired outcomes. This involves asking relevant questions, seeking clarification when needed, and taking note of any specific instructions or guidelines they provide.
2. Initial Consultation: Conduct an initial consultation with the client to gather comprehensive information about the project. This can be done through face-to-face meetings, phone calls, or video conferences. During this stage, discuss the project scope, timeline, budget, target audience, intended message, and any existing branding or style guidelines. This consultation helps establish a clear understanding of the client's expectations.
